			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://heapssausages.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/StAndrewsDayPoster.png"><img class=" wp-image-212 alignleft" style="border-image: initial; border-width: 10px; border-color: white; border-style: solid;" title="StAndrewsDayPoster" src="http://heapssausages.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/StAndrewsDayPoster-217x300.png" alt="" width="78" height="108" /></a><em><strong>St Andrew&#8217;s Day</strong> is the feast day of <a title="Saint Andrew"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Saint_Andrew">Saint Andrew</a>. It is celebrated on 30 November. Saint Andrew is the patron saint of Scotland and St Andrew&#8217;s Day is Scotland&#8217;s official national day. In 2006, the Scottish Parliament designated St Andrew&#8217;s Day as an official bank holiday. </em></p>
<p>Another Calendar date like St Andrews Day means another opportunity to rustle up a special sausage recipe and this year for St Andrews Day Heaps are very happy to present the <strong>Braveheart Banger!</strong></p>
<p>Its made with Pork, Black Pudding, Wildflower Honey &amp; Apple. Guaranteed to keep you warm, even if you&#8217;re wearing your kilt!</p>

<h3>Know your sausages &#8211; How to pick the best of British pork bangers</h3>
<p>We are a nation obsessed with sausages. Last year, according to market research company Kantar Worldpanel, we consumed around 132m kg and spent nearly £500m on them. Sales have risen by more than 13% in the last two years, with some supermarkets recording increases of 30%. Our ultimate favourites are pork, but how many of us know what is going into them?&#8230;</p>
